Let R be the region between the graph y = sqrt(x) and the line y =x, 0 < x < 1. A solid has R as its base, and
the cross sections perpendicular to the x-axis are squares. Then the volume of this solid is:
a) 8/15
b) 1/15
c) 8/25
d) 1/30
e) 7/25
f) 1/6
